Greetings, Groove-ophiles! If you thought Jim Starlin was the first to take
Captain Mar-Vell on a trippy metamorphosis, you might wanna think again! In
Captain Marvel #11 (December 1968), Arnold Drake, new penciler Dick Ayers, and Vinnie Colletta killed off Marv's true love,
Una; had his arch-enemy
Yon-Rogg send our
Kree Captain on a faster-than-light rocket ride to seeming oblivion; then made slight costume alterations
and created a new set of powers for
Mar-Vell at the hands of the mysterious entity known as...
Zo (
Oz backwards--get it?). Not sayin' they did it better than Judo Jim (just can't beat Judo Jim!), but they dood it first! Prepare to meet "...a new Mar-Vell..." in..."Rebirth!"
